How they compare

Latvia currently reports 10.3% against 9.9% in Bosnia and Herzegovina, a difference of 0.4%.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 20 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Latvia ahead.

Bosnia and Herzegovina ranks 132nd and Latvia ranks 131st of 153 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Bosnia and Herzegovina averaged higher in 1 and Latvia in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Bosnia and Herzegovina Latvia Difference Ahead
2000s 3.1% 12.5% 9.4% Latvia
2010s 7.2% 8.5% 1.2% Latvia
2020s 9.0% 8.3% 0.7% Bosnia and Herzegovina

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Taxes on income, profits, and capital gains are taxes payable on the actual or presumed incomes, profits and capital gains.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of revenue which includes all transactions that add to the amount of economic value of a unit or sector.
